Don't rush out and get it all at once, you will make mistakes and end up with stuff you never use.
I will tell you what I use for my 10 mile each way commute and you can then have a think about if this will suit you too. I also don't have to cycle everyday so mix driving and cycling which is useful, as on my driving days I can take fresh clothes and towels to work ready for the cycling days. I have showers and a locker so start each day freshly washed in clean clothes.
I don't wear padded cycling shorts so have a mixture of walking/MTB type shorts and some running leggings for colder days. Eventually moved away from the tights type leggings to a slightly looser jogging legging as I get changed 30-40 minutes before the end of the day and walking around the office in tights for that last 30 minutes wasn't really appropriate. I'm not self-conscious so don't really care, but the looser pants do the same job without having to inflict the sight of my finely chiselled contours on the rest of my colleagues
Tops are a mixture of general base layer vests, sport tops and some MTB tops. Nothing roadie or aero for the commute (or any ride actually). As long as it is comfy, doesn't get too sweaty and can dry before hometime (then gets washed after one trip!), although anything will get sweaty on a 10 mile sprint/commute.

For that biblical monsoon day I also have a full wet weather kit of breathable nightvision jacket, Endura gridlock over trousers and BBB heavyduty overshoes. It might sound daft but even when the conditions are at their worst you will still want to do the ride 'just because you can'.....
